Out here you're genuinely close to water—Duck Lake sits just a third of a mile off, and Crooked Lake Public Access is a five-minute walk if you need to stretch your legs toward the shore. Grocery shopping means a short drive of about a mile and change, which is the kind of distance that stops feeling like a hassle after the first month. The nearest major airport runs roughly 44 minutes, so it's not a commuter's shortcut but entirely manageable when you need to go. The roads are there, the lots are platted, and the bones of the place are straightforward—what you're looking at is land that's already mapped out and ready to build on, with reasonable access to both supplies and the water that makes this part of Michigan actually worth the acreage.
